Cernit clay is a versatile polymer clay known for its flexibility, durability, and vibrant colors, making it a popular choice for various arts and crafts projects.

Cernit clay is a premium polymer clay that artists and crafters love for its unique properties. This clay is ideal for creating detailed sculptures, jewelry, and decorative items. One of the standout features of Cernit clay is its ability to hold fine details, making it perfect for intricate designs. Additionally, it comes in a wide range of vibrant colors, allowing for endless creative possibilities.

When working with Cernit clay, users appreciate its smooth texture, which makes it easy to mold and shape. After baking, the clay becomes strong and durable, ensuring that your creations last. Whether you are a beginner or an experienced artist, Cernit clay offers a user-friendly experience that can enhance your crafting skills.

Yes, you can easily mix different colors of Cernit clay to create custom shades and effects, enhancing your creative possibilities.

Bake Cernit clay according to the instructions provided on the packaging, typically at around 130°C (265°F) for 30 minutes per 6mm thickness. Always use a reliable oven thermometer to ensure accurate temperature.
